    @joachimvzm4274 ปีที่แล้ว +161

    Some interesting character continuity here. Of the Huldra Brothers, Sindri was always the one who was worse about holding grudges and generally refusing to let go. Remember their feud in GoW 2018? Yeah, both brothers badmouthed each other, but as we figure out through the game, Brok is just ALWAYS badmouthing people. He doesn't really mean any of it and he still cares about Sindri, even going so far as to ask Atreus how he's doing, and when Sindri shows up wanting to reconcile Brok is immediately receptive. But Sindri? Nary a good word about Brok comes out of his mouth and it takes a hurtful lashing out from Atreus for him to even entertain the idea that their feud might not have been all Brok's fault. Sindri never shows any concern for Brok until after they reconcile, and even goes so far as to be incredulous when told that Brok is concerned about him. This trait stays with him in Ragnarok. Note nobody in the house - not even Brok - holds Atreus running to Asgard against him...except Sindri. Sindri genuinely seemed to have taken it personally that Atreus didn't listen and got him hurt. The cut to Kratos was far deeper, and Brok was literally mauled by the undead and neither of the two held it against Atreus at all.
    Sindri turning his back on Atreus was set up all the way back in GoW4. He's been a vindictive man with a propensity for grudges from the moment we've met him.
